As far as the photo chosen goes, I’ve only seen this situation happen once in all my travels. The location, time of year, weather and light, road and camera position – all lined up:

The scene lasted just a few minutes. Time enough for me to pull over, set up a tripod and capture this image on a Leica R6, 180mm f/2.8 Elmarit, and Fujichrome 50.
